American Resources Corporation (NASDAQ: AREC) operates at the intersection of traditional metallurgical coal production and emerging critical minerals recovery, making its news coverage uniquely varied. As both an Appalachian Basin coal producer serving steelmakers and the parent company of ReElement Technologies focused on rare earth elements and magnesium recovery, developments from AREC span conventional mining announcements and strategic materials supply chain initiatives.

American Resources Corporation (NASDAQ:AREC) has resumed shipments of specialty stoker carbon from its Perry County Resources (PCR) complex. The PCR mine is expanding its production capabilities by deploying three continuous miners, with plans to increase to five throughout the year. The complex aims to create over 170 well-paying jobs while producing 1.0 - 1.5 million tons of carbon annually. Additionally, the company is preparing its McCoy Elkhorn complex to produce 350,000 - 500,000 tons of metallurgical carbon, expecting further job creation and operational scaling in 2021.

American Resources Corporation (NASDAQ:AREC) announced the successful closing of the initial public offering (IPO) for its SPAC, American Acquisition Opportunity Inc., raising $100 million through the sale of 10 million units at $10.00 each. Each unit includes one share of Class A common stock and one-half of a redeemable warrant. The SPAC aims to target land and resource holding companies, fostering innovation for the new economy. The underwriters also received a 45-day option for an additional 1.5 million units. The IPO's success signals confidence in the company’s strategy.

American Resources Corporation (AREC) announced plans to build a 2kW mobile electrolytic cell facility for rare earth element (REE) processing, advancing its commercialization efforts. Utilizing acquired technology, the facility aims to valorize coal and coal byproducts, producing REE concentrates, carbon, and hydrogen. With a capital expenditure of under $1 million, the facility's design allows for on-site processing, enhancing logistical efficiency. The company is also interviewing project managers for construction, expecting completion by late 2021.

American Resources Corporation (NASDAQ:AREC) has reported its fourth quarter and full year 2020 financial results, highlighting a net loss of $10.26 million or $0.35 per share, a significant reduction from $70.9 million or $2.94 per share in 2019. Revenue for 2020 was $1.06 million, down from $24.4 million in 2019, as operations were idled due to the COVID-19 pandemic. Key highlights include the launch of American Rare Earth LLC, advancements in ESG initiatives, and significant debt reduction efforts. The company maintains revenue guidance of $55 million to $75 million for 2021, supported by enhanced balance sheet strength.

American Resources Corporation (NASDAQ:AREC) expands its patent portfolio, enhancing its "Capture. Process. Purify." technology for rare earth mineral production. The new patents focus on coal electrolysis to separate rare earth elements and produce graphene, hydrogen, and other valuable byproducts. Developed by Dr. Gerardine Botte, these technologies enable efficient recycling of waste materials, including fly ash, and promise environmental benefits.
